style: Use `iter` for IntoIterator parameter names
This commit standardizes the codebase on `iter` for parameters with IntoIterator bounds. Previously about 40% of IntoIterator parameters were named `iterable`, with most of the rest being named `iter`. There was a single place where it was named `iterator`.
